This binding support the HEOS-System from Denon for OpenHab 2. The binding provides basic control for the player and groups of the network. It also supports selecting favorites and play them on several players or groups on the HEOS-Network. The binding first establish a connection to one of the player of the HEOS-Network and use them as a bridge. After a connection is established, the binding searches for all player and grouped via the bridge. To keep the network traffic low it is recommended to establish only one bridge. Connection to the bridge is done via a Telnet connection.

This binding support full automatic discovery of bridges, players and groups. It is recommended to use the PaperUI to setup the system and add all players and groups. The bridge is discovered through UPnP in the local network. Once it is added the players and groups are read via the bridge and placed within the inbox. Nether the less also manual configuration is possible
This binding does not require any configuration via a .cfg file. The configuration is done via the Thing definition. Within the binding the callback URL can be set. This URL is needed if a player or a group is registered as an audio sink within OpenHab. The URL is in most of the cases the URL if the OpenHab server. Also the port has to be defined. Example: http://192.168.0.7:8080 or if the sound file is located on the OpenHab server http://localhost:8080

The bridge can be added via the PaperUI. After adding the bridge the user name and password can set by editing the thing via the PaperUI. For manual configuration the following parameter can be defined. The ipAddress has to be defined. All other fields are optional.
Bridge heos:bridge:main "name" [ipAddress="192.168.0.1", name="Default", unserName="xxx", password="123456"]
Player can be added via the PaperUI. All fields are then filled automatically. For manual configuration the player is defined as followed:
Thing heos:player:pid "name" [pid="123456789", name="name", model="modelName", ipAdress="192.168.0.xxx", type="Player"]
PID behind the heos:player:--- should be changed as required. Every name or value can be used. It is recommended to use the player PID. Within the configuration the PID as well as the type field is mandatory. The rest is not required.
If player is configured by PaperUI the UID of the player is equal to the player ID (PID) from the HEOS system
Thing heos:group:memberHash "name" [gid="123456789", name="name", model="modelName", ipAdress="192.168.0.xxx", type="Group", memberHash="123456789"]
If group is configured by PaperUI the group UID is calculated by the Hash value of the group members
Required fields are the GID which is the PID of the group leading player and the type which is Group here.

Reboot | Switch | Reboot the whole HEOS System. Can be used if you get in trouble with the system |
DynamicGroupHandling | Switch | If this option id activated the system automatically removes groups if they are ungrouped. Only works if the group is added via an UI. |
BuildGroup | Switch | Is used to define a group. The player which shall be grouped has to be selected first. If Switch is then activated the group is build. |
Playlists | String | Plays a playlist on the prior selected Player Channel (see below) Playlists are identified by numbers. List can be found in the HEOS App |
RawCommand | String | A channel where every HEOS CLI command can be send to. |
PlayURL | String | Plays a media file located at the URL. First select the player channel where the stram shall be played. Then send the stream via the Play URL channel. |

Also the bridge supports dynamic channels which represent the player of the network and the favorites. They are dynamically added if player are found and if favorites are defined within the HEOS Account. To activate Favorites the system has to be signed in to the HEOS Account.

This section gives some detailed explanations how to use the binding.
Players can be grouped via the binding. To do so, select the player channels of the players you want to group at the bridge and then use the "Made Group" channel to create the group. The first player which is selected will be the group leader. The group GID then is the same as the PID of the group leader. Therefore changing play pause and some other things at the leading player will also change that at the group. Muting and the Volume on the other hand can be changed individually for each player also for the group leader. If you want to change that for the whole group you have to do it via the group thing.
To play inputs like the Aux In can be played at eacht player or group. It is also possible to play an input from an other player at the selected player. To do so, first select the player channel of the player where the input is located (source) at the bridge. Then use the input channel of the player where the source shall be played (destination) to activate the input.

Groups are a more or less dynamic item compared to the players. The players are always present within the network and are only added or removed if they are added or removed physically. Groups on the other hand are dynamic because they are only virtual created and removed. Therefore dynamic group handling only sets groups to OFFLINE if the option is activated. This is indicated via the "OnlineStatus" channel of the group. If the group then is created again the binding automatically sets the status to online without the need of action by the user. If dynamic group handling is deactivated the group thing is completely removed if the binding is notified about a removed group. The group then has to be added manually again if created.
Playlists can be played by sending the number (starts at 0!) to the binding via the playlists channel at the bridge. To find the correct number for the playlist have a look to the HEOS App and see at which position the playlist you want to play is located. To tell the binding at which player or group the playlist shall be played, select the related player or group channel at the bridge prior sending the command to the playlist channel.
